Always Call Forward

The following figure illustrates successful call forwarding between Yealink SIP IP phones in
which User B has enabled always call forward. The incoming call is immediately forwarded to
User C when User A calls User B. In this call flow scenario, the end users are User A, User B, and
User C. They are all using Yealink SIP IP phones, which are connected via an IP network.
The call flow scenario is as follows:
User B enables always call forward, and the destination number is User C.
1.
User A calls User B.
2.
User B forwards the incoming call to User C.
3.
User C answers the call.
4.
Call is established between User A and User C.
